Mega Man X: Comman Mission rowenisopirus
From start to finish the endless plots, hidden area and repeatability due to so many side things and namely the crazy high powered hidden boss rush - Megaman X fans have found this turn based RPG to be a true highlight of the series that introduces brand new playable characters right along side the three most focused ones through it's known history.
Drama, Action, Plot Twists, the list just goes on and on. The creators have set a bar with this creation that simply has not been beaten for so many years under this title. The gameplay is easy to pick up on and characters so fun to switch between it's story was so well written even gamers doing end game rushes for that special SupraForce Metal still can't get enough of those new legendary ultimate, along with several known classics like Black Zero.
From sending mission teams out to unearth special keys to locked areas, collectables, movie clips, action figures, and even a full sound track in the media department, the endless hours someone could play trying to reach 100% goes to question - did you really get everything? With a repeating ending allowing an even higher growth point, what is too powerful now?
